Tips for Hosting a Successful Game Night

To ensure your game night is a success, there are a few important tips to keep in mind. First and foremost, consider the number of people you invite and choose games accordingly. It’s crucial to ensure that everyone is equally enthusiastic about playing games to create a lively and engaging atmosphere.

Choosing the right games prior to the event can help avoid any disagreements and ensure that everyone is excited to participate. Gathering input from your guests or having a selection of games for them to choose from can also help cater to different preferences and interests.

Additionally, providing extra games and activities can keep the fun going even after the main game has finished. This ensures that there are options for everyone to enjoy throughout the night. Having a variety of games available allows guests to choose what they are most interested in and keeps the energy level high.

Creating the perfect ambiance can make all the difference. Clearing off the coffee table and making space for games ensures that everyone has enough room to play comfortably. Consider using tablecloths, candles, or other decorations that match your game night theme to set the mood and create a festive atmosphere.

When it comes to food and drinks, opt for easy finger foods that guests can enjoy without interrupting the game. Keep it simple and offer a variety of snacks to cater to different tastes. Desserts and plenty of drinks, both alcoholic and non-alcoholic, are essential to keep everyone energized and in good spirits throughout the night.

Remember, the key to hosting a successful game night is ensuring that everyone is having fun. Encourage friendly competition, good sportsmanship, and create an inclusive environment where everyone feels comfortable. By following these tips, you can host a memorable game night that will have your friends and family looking forward to the next one.

Game Night Theme Ideas

Adding a theme to your game night can take the fun and excitement to a whole new level. It helps create a cohesive and immersive experience for you and your guests. Here are some popular game night theme ideas to inspire your next themed game night:

Holiday-Themed Game Night

Liven up your game night by adding a festive touch with a holiday-themed game night. Whether it’s Christmas, Halloween, or any other holiday, incorporating holiday-themed decorations, snacks, and games can make your game night extra special.

Puzzles and Brain Teasers

Challenge your guests’ problem-solving skills with a puzzles and brain teasers game night. Set up various puzzles, riddles, and mind-bending challenges for everyone to solve. This theme is perfect for those who enjoy a mental workout and love a good challenge.

Trivia Game Night

Put your knowledge to the test with a trivia game night. Choose a specific category such as movies, music, or sports, or have a mix of different topics. Prepare a trivia quiz or play trivia board games to keep everyone engaged and entertained.

Minute to Win It Challenges

Add a thrilling and fast-paced element to your game night with minute to win it challenges. Set up a series of exciting and hilarious one-minute challenges using household items. From stacking cups to balloon popping, these challenges will have everyone laughing and cheering each other on.

Classic Board Game Night

Take a trip down memory lane with a classic board game night. Dust off your favorite board games like Monopoly, Scrabble, or Clue, and enjoy an evening of friendly competition and nostalgia. This theme is perfect for those who appreciate traditional games that never go out of style.

Choosing a game night theme adds a unique twist to your gathering and sets the stage for a memorable experience. It also helps guide your game selection, decorations, and invitations, making everything come together seamlessly. So, get creative and have a blast with your themed game night!

Choosing the Right Games for Game Night

The choice of games is crucial for a successful game night. Depending on the preferences and size of your group, you can choose from a variety of games. Classic board games such as Ticket to Ride and Catan are great options for larger groups, while card games like Cards Against Humanity and party games like Heads Up! are ideal for smaller gatherings. It’s essential to select games that match the interests and skill levels of your guests to ensure everyone has a great time.

If you have a larger group of friends and family coming over for game night, board games provide excellent entertainment options. With their strategic gameplay and multiplayer capabilities, board games create a dynamic and engaging atmosphere. Consider games like Monopoly, Settlers of Catan, or Scrabble for a classic, competitive experience.

For smaller, more intimate game nights, card games offer a great way to foster connection and friendly competition. Card games like Uno, Poker, or Exploding Kittens are easy to learn and can be played in a casual setting. These games encourage interaction and laughter, making them perfect for close-knit gatherings.

If you’re looking to liven up the atmosphere and get everyone involved, party games are the way to go. Games like Charades, Pictionary, or Taboo are guaranteed to elicit laughter and create unforgettable moments. These games often rely on teamwork and creativity, ensuring everyone has an opportunity to participate and shine.

When selecting games for game night, it’s important to consider the preferences of your guests. Take into account their gaming experience, interests, and the overall mood you want to create. Variety is key, so be sure to have a mix of different game types to cater to different tastes. Remember, the goal is to have a fun and inclusive game night where everyone can enjoy themselves.

Themed Cocktail Recipes:

Cocktail Name Ingredients Instructions
Game Night Margarita
  • 2 oz tequila
  • 1 oz lime juice
  • 1 oz triple sec
  • 1 tsp sugar
  • Salt for rimming the glass
  • Lime wedge for garnish
  1. Rim the glass with salt.
  2. In a shaker, combine tequila, lime juice, triple sec, and sugar. Shake well.
  3. Strain the mixture into the rimmed glass filled with ice.
  4. Garnish with a lime wedge.
Board Game Bellini
  • 2 oz peach puree
  • 4 oz champagne or sparkling wine
  • Mint sprig for garnish
  1. Add peach puree to a champagne flute.
  2. Top with champagne or sparkling wine.
  3. Garnish with a mint sprig.
Trivia Tequila Sunrise
  • 2 oz tequila
  • 4 oz orange juice
  • 1/2 oz grenadine
  • Orange slice and cherry for garnish
  1. In a glass, combine tequila and orange juice.
  2. Add ice and stir well.
  3. Gently pour grenadine down the side of the glass to create a sunrise effect.
  4. Garnish with an orange slice and a cherry.

When it comes to game night invitations, creativity is key. Here are some invitation ideas to inspire you:

1. Digital Invitations

Embrace the convenience and versatility of digital invitations. Websites and apps like Evite, Paperless Post, and Canva offer a wide range of customizable invitation templates. You can easily add images, graphics, and even interactive elements to make your invitation stand out. Sending digital invitations also allows for easy RSVP tracking and reminders.

2. Themed Invitations

Match your game night theme with themed invitations. For example, if you’re hosting a trivia game night, design your invitations like quiz cards or trivia questionnaires. If it’s a board game night, create invitations that resemble classic board game boxes. Adding themed elements to your invitations sets the tone for the event and gets guests excited about the games to come.

3. Handmade Invitations

For a personal touch, consider making handmade invitations. Get crafty with colorful cardstock, markers, stickers, and other decorative materials. You can create custom invitations that reflect your unique style and the spirit of your game night. Handmade invitations show your guests that you’ve put thought and effort into the event.

4. Interactive Invitations

Make your invitations more engaging with interactive elements. For example, you can design a puzzle invitation where guests have to solve a riddle or complete a crossword to reveal the event details. Another idea is to create a scratch-off invitation where guests have to scratch off a silver layer to unveil the game night theme. These interactive invitations add an element of surprise and make the invitation process more fun.
